Beast of Wealth: Overview

Beast of Wealth is one of three titles in Play’n GO’s trio of wealth based slots. Wealth by name, wealth by nature since all three have been built around progressive jackpots. This isn’t exactly Play’n GO’s usual stomping ground, so the studio has come out swinging by releasing three at once. Maybe the idea is that at least one becomes a player favourite? Or perhaps they had a stack of Asian-themed assets and code ready to repurpose. Hard to say. What’s clear is that all three lean into Asian styling and are aimed at big win hunters chasing four progressive jackpots.

Against the other entries in the trilogy, Beast of Wealth comes across as the most traditional in appearance. When it loads, there’s no doubt about the setting. The 5-reel, 243 win ways play area sits inside a wooden, temple-like frame topped with a tiled roof in classic Asian style. Lanterns dangle from the structure, while misty mountains loom in the background. As mentioned, it’s a more classic Asian presentation.

Players can join the chase with stakes from 10 p/c to $/€100 per spin, whether on mobile, tablets, or desktop. The math model mirrors Celebration of Wealth and Temple of Wealth in many respects, including a fairly high but not savage volatility, which the studio lists as 7/10. RTP has dipped a touch to a default of 96.17%, still a strong number for a progressive given that each bet contributes to the jackpots. Still, it’s worth checking the paytable before you start, because as with other Play’n GO releases, RTP is variable and may appear at a lower setting.

The paytable offers 10 standard symbols – 6 low pay royals and 4 higher-value icons. The premium set is a stylised mix of beasts such as turtles, birds, tigers, and dragons. Landing five premium symbols across a win line pays from 2 to 10 times the stake. Wild combinations pay the same as the high pay dragon. Shaped like a gong, the wild can land anywhere and substitutes for any symbol except the scatter to help complete winning combinations.

Beast of Wealth: Features

Beast of Wealth – free spins

Beast of Wealth keeps things as straightforward as its sister slots in the feature department. The base game rolls along in a fairly standard way until a bonus is activated. There are two in total – free spins and the jackpot feature.

The Yin & Yang symbol is the key to triggering free spins. It can land on any reel and pays 5, 10, or 50 times the stake for 3, 4, or 5 on screen. Getting at least 3 anywhere in view starts the free spins round, and as before, players get five choices to pick from:

  • Turtles – 118 Turtle symbols added to the reels.
  • Birds – 108 Bird symbols added to the reels.
  • Tigers – 98 Tiger symbols added to the reels.
  • Dragons – 88 Dragon symbols added to the reels.

The 5th selection is a mystery option that grants 88-118 of any symbol type. The dragon is appealing because it’s the top-paying symbol on the paytable, but fewer of them are added, which makes it tougher to connect wins. Put simply, the option you choose can noticeably shift the volatility.

In free spins, every other premium symbol is stripped out, meaning only the selected symbol can appear during the feature. The bonus starts with 8 free spins and can be retriggered by landing three or more scatter symbols.

Scatters are useful, but if you’re chasing the jackpot, it’s Gold Reels you’ll be hoping for. On any base game spin, between 1 and 5 reels can randomly become Gold Reels. If a wild lands on at least one Gold Reel, it activates the jackpot feature. Once it begins, players see 12 logo coins and pick them one at a time to uncover jackpots – the Mini, Minor, Major, and Grand. Find three matching jackpots to claim that prize. As with the other games, 1.5% of each stake is taken to build the jackpot pool, and higher bets improve your odds of triggering a jackpot.

Beast of Wealth: Verdict

In truth, it’s largely a case of more of the same, because Beast of Wealth echoes the other two games in the series in so many respects. The bonus has been adjusted, but the core appeal remains taking shots at the progressive jackpots. Beast of Wealth leans a bit more into the Asian theme, yet there isn’t a huge amount that truly separates the three. They share similar stats, similar math models, and the non-jackpot upside is much like it was before.

So how should players pick one over the others? Realistically, it’s not easy. They’re all connected to the same network, meaning players may effectively be chasing the same prizes. The free spins setups do vary, though, so trying all three in demo mode is probably the best way to settle on a personal favourite.
